Specialized Prosecutor’s Office charges leader of political party with espionage

Photo: BGNES

The Specialized Prosecutor’s Office has submitted an indictment to the Specialized Criminal Court against a leader of a political party. The charges are of espionage with the aim of disclosing a state secret.

The prosecutor’s office is not revealing the name of the political party or of the leader charged with espionage, only his initials – N.M. A multitude of investigative actions have been taken in the course of the investigation – interrogation of witnesses, house searches, confiscation, computer and technical expert reports, handwriting analysis, collection of evidence and documents.

An executive session of the court is to be scheduled.
